Output 99026ddb2f6ab8694e4ba0a0a81a8a0c8bb055dc42ef82a025059df18de9ecae:11

value
161180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4414f64677f63ee6605f488e9e633a54912e7f0 OP_EQUAL
address
3M3KR3D6ryz6GFADmdbDif3v15ZPMGKear
transaction
99026ddb2f6ab8694e4ba0a0a81a8a0c8bb055dc42ef82a025059df18de9ecae
spent
true